Mac Android Studio 3.0 Terminal 中文乱码问题处理

作者:为何是Hex的昵称 时间:2023-08-12 13:42:09 

前几天,收到 AS 发布的 3.0 更新,就迫不及待的更新了,更新后发现整个界面的画风都变了,和 IDEA 更像了
本人是命令行重度使用患者,平时都是使用 AS 下面的 Terminal,升级完成后,使用 git log 命令查看历史 log,发现中文全部显示不出来

开始以为是 git 的问题,经测试现象如下


Mac Android Studio 3.0 Terminal 中文乱码问题处理

直接输入中文会显示 <00e6><0096> 云云,使用 ls 命令查看会显示 ??? 一堆问号,使用 ls | grep 反而正常,具体原因不详

后来在 Google 上找解决方法,有人说


# Add this line into ~/.bash_profile or ~/.zshrc
export LANG=en_US.UTF-8

我使用的是 zsh ,所以就向 ~/.zshrc 文件里加入上述一段文字,经测试,发现中文可以正常显示了
后来发现 ~/.zshrc 文件中存在


# export LANG=en_US.UTF-8

只不过是注释的状态,直接打开注释,然后 source 一下文件即可

PS:解决前

Mac Android Studio 3.0 Terminal 中文乱码问题处理

解决后

Mac Android Studio 3.0 Terminal 中文乱码问题处理

希望对大家使用Android Studio3.0能够有所帮助

来源:http://www.jianshu.com/p/6a5a27b2a2da

标签:Android,Studio
0
投稿

猜你喜欢

  • 老生常谈C/C++内存管理

    2022-05-07 02:17:10
  • Android 7.0调用相机崩溃详解及解决办法

    2023-08-08 21:39:42
  • SpringBoot自动装配原理详解

    2023-07-26 08:44:46
  • springboot 按月分表的实现方式

    2023-11-25 00:03:47
  • 解析Java和Eclipse中加载本地库(.dll文件)的详细说明

    2023-11-11 01:23:31
  • C#常见应用函数实例小结

    2022-10-17 02:35:46
  • Android手动检查并申请权限方法

    2023-08-04 23:14:17
  • SpringMVC利用dropzone组件实现图片上传

    2022-01-19 00:37:00
  • spring获取bean的源码解析

    2023-10-11 22:15:43
  • Spring Boot热加载jar实现动态插件的思路

    2021-09-25 16:37:55
  • Winform中如何跨线程访问UI元素

    2023-04-26 08:12:10
  • Android多渠道打包神器ProductFlavor详解

    2021-06-11 19:48:22
  • springboot如何通过@PropertySource加载自定义yml文件

    2022-08-06 19:42:56
  • 实现Android 滑动退出Activity的功能

    2023-04-24 03:00:34
  • C#入门之定义类成员与接口实现

    2023-05-25 09:50:58
  • java实现ArrayList根据存储对象排序功能示例

    2022-01-24 01:06:05
  • Spring maven filtering使用方法详解

    2021-07-02 22:14:46
  • Java遍历Properties所有元素的方法实例

    2022-09-08 14:58:24
  • maven 配置多个仓库的方法

    2021-06-09 03:30:24
  • Java使用JDBC连接postgresql数据库示例

    2022-11-06 22:49:02
  • asp之家 软件编程 m.aspxhome.com